欧美在线观看视频网站,亚洲熟妇色自偷自拍另类,啪啪伊人网,中文字幕第13亚洲另类,中文成人久久久久影院免费观看 ,精品人妻人人做人人爽,亚洲a视频

多終端多協(xié)議流媒體發(fā)布方法與流程

文檔序號:12068201閱讀:553來源:國知局

本發(fā)明涉及網(wǎng)絡(luò)通信領(lǐng)域以及流媒體通信領(lǐng)域;更具體地說,本發(fā)明涉及一種多終端多協(xié)議流媒體發(fā)布方法。



背景技術(shù):

流媒體(Streaming Media)指在數(shù)據(jù)網(wǎng)絡(luò)上按時間先后次序傳輸和播放的連續(xù)的音/視頻數(shù)據(jù)流。最早,用戶在網(wǎng)絡(luò)上觀看視頻或者收聽音頻時,必須先將整個影音文件下載并存儲在本地計算機上,然后才可以觀看。與這種下載后播放的傳統(tǒng)播放方式不同的是,流媒體在播放前并不下載整個文件,只將部分內(nèi)容緩存,同時剩余流媒體數(shù)據(jù)流則邊傳送邊播放,這樣就節(jié)省了下載等待時間和存儲空間。

流媒體數(shù)據(jù)流具有三個特點:連續(xù)性(Continuous)、實時性(Real-time)、時序性,即其數(shù)據(jù)流具有嚴(yán)格的前后時序關(guān)系。

為了實現(xiàn)流媒體的傳輸,現(xiàn)有技術(shù)提出了一些具體的解決方案,例如:

實時流協(xié)議RTSP(Real Time Streaming Protocol)是由哥倫比亞大學(xué)、網(wǎng)景Netscape和RealNetworks(RealPlayer播放器的制造商)共同提出的,該協(xié)議定義了一對多應(yīng)用程序如何有效地通過IP網(wǎng)絡(luò)傳送多媒體數(shù)據(jù)。

MMS協(xié)議(Microsoft Media Server protocol)用來訪問并流式接收WindowsMedia服務(wù)器中.asf文件的一種協(xié)議。MMS協(xié)議用于訪問Windows Media發(fā)布點上的單播內(nèi)容。MMS是連接WindowsMedia單播服務(wù)的默認(rèn)方法。若觀眾在Windows Media Player中鍵入一個URL以連接內(nèi)容,而不是通過超級鏈接訪問內(nèi)容,則他們必須使用MMS協(xié)議引用該流。

但是,在現(xiàn)有技術(shù)中,還沒有很好的解決方案能夠?qū)崿F(xiàn)流媒體的全平臺(例如包括iOS、安卓、Windows、Mac)適配播放。



技術(shù)實現(xiàn)要素:

本發(fā)明所要解決的技術(shù)問題是針對現(xiàn)有技術(shù)中存在上述缺陷,提供一種能夠?qū)崿F(xiàn)流媒體的全平臺(例如包括iOS、安卓、Windows、Mac)適配播放的多終端多協(xié)議流媒體發(fā)布方法。

根據(jù)本發(fā)明,提供了一種多終端多協(xié)議流媒體發(fā)布方法,包括:

第一步驟:直播錄播發(fā)起方利用第一數(shù)據(jù)格式向直播錄播云端的直播服務(wù)器和錄播服務(wù)器傳送流媒體數(shù)據(jù);

第二步驟:直播服務(wù)器和錄播服務(wù)器分別對接收到的流媒體數(shù)據(jù)進(jìn)行錄制轉(zhuǎn)碼和存儲;

第三步驟:直播錄播云端基于第一網(wǎng)絡(luò)協(xié)議向第一類接收終端傳送經(jīng)錄制轉(zhuǎn)碼和存儲的流媒體數(shù)據(jù);

第四步驟:直播錄播云端基于第二網(wǎng)絡(luò)協(xié)議向第二類接收終端傳送經(jīng)錄制轉(zhuǎn)碼和存儲的流媒體數(shù)據(jù)。

優(yōu)選地,第一數(shù)據(jù)格式為h.264格式或者M(jìn)P4格式。

優(yōu)選地,第一網(wǎng)絡(luò)協(xié)議是路由選擇表維護(hù)協(xié)議,而且第一類接收終端包含安卓終端、Windows終端和MAC終端。

優(yōu)選地,第一類接收終端通過Flash播放器觀看直播和/或錄播。

優(yōu)選地,第二網(wǎng)絡(luò)協(xié)議是HLS協(xié)議,而且第二類接收終端包含iOS終端。

優(yōu)選地,第二類接收終端通過HTML5播放器觀看直播和/或錄播。

本發(fā)明通過一種特殊的視頻文件加載格式實現(xiàn)了一個直播/錄播音視頻流即可實現(xiàn)流媒體的全平臺(iOS、安卓、Windows、Mac)適配播放。本發(fā)明實現(xiàn)了直播/錄播一次發(fā)布即可同時支持多種協(xié)議(RTMP/HLS)多種終端(iOS、安卓、PC及Mac)流暢高清播放。而且,本發(fā)明可以自動適配客戶端平臺并選擇合適的播放器格式,例如HTML5播放器或者Flash播放器。

本發(fā)明兼容性強,一個直播/錄播流適配多種協(xié)議多種平臺;而且,本發(fā)明可以適應(yīng)多種場景,既支持直播又支持錄播。

附圖說明

結(jié)合附圖,并通過參考下面的詳細(xì)描述,將會更容易地對本發(fā)明有更完整的理解并且更容易地理解其伴隨的優(yōu)點和特征,其中:

圖1示意性地示出了根據(jù)本發(fā)明優(yōu)選實施例的多終端多協(xié)議流媒體發(fā)布方法的示意圖。

需要說明的是,附圖用于說明本發(fā)明,而非限制本發(fā)明。注意,表示結(jié)構(gòu)的附圖可能并非按比例繪制。并且,附圖中,相同或者類似的元件標(biāo)有相同或者類似的標(biāo)號。

具體實施方式

為了使本發(fā)明的內(nèi)容更加清楚和易懂,下面結(jié)合具體實施例和附圖對本發(fā)明的內(nèi)容進(jìn)行詳細(xì)描述。

圖1示意性地示出了根據(jù)本發(fā)明優(yōu)選實施例的多終端多協(xié)議流媒體發(fā)布方法的示意圖。

如圖1所示,根據(jù)本發(fā)明優(yōu)選實施例的多終端多協(xié)議流媒體發(fā)布方法包括:

第一步驟:直播錄播發(fā)起方10利用第一數(shù)據(jù)格式向直播錄播云端20的直播服務(wù)器21和錄播服務(wù)器22傳送流媒體數(shù)據(jù);

例如,第一數(shù)據(jù)格式為h.264格式或者M(jìn)P4格式。

第二步驟:直播服務(wù)器21和錄播服務(wù)器22分別對接收到的流媒體數(shù)據(jù)進(jìn)行錄制轉(zhuǎn)碼和存儲;

第三步驟:直播錄播云端基于第一網(wǎng)絡(luò)協(xié)議向第一類接收終端30傳送經(jīng)錄制轉(zhuǎn)碼和存儲的流媒體數(shù)據(jù);

例如,第一網(wǎng)絡(luò)協(xié)議是路由選擇表維護(hù)協(xié)議(Real-Time Messaging Protocol,RTMP),而且第一類接收終端包含安卓終端、Windows終端和MAC終端。這樣,用戶可以在安卓終端、Windows終端及Mac終端通過RTMP傳輸數(shù)據(jù)流,客戶端通過Flash播放器觀看直播/錄播。

第四步驟:直播錄播云端基于第二網(wǎng)絡(luò)協(xié)議向第二類接收終端40傳送經(jīng)錄制轉(zhuǎn)碼和存儲的流媒體數(shù)據(jù)。

例如,第二網(wǎng)絡(luò)協(xié)議是HLS(Http Live Streaming)協(xié)議,而且第二類接收終端包含iOS終端。這樣,用戶可以在iOS設(shè)備通過HLS協(xié)議傳輸數(shù)據(jù)流,客戶端通過HTML5播放器觀看直播/錄播。

由此,服務(wù)端支持多協(xié)議視頻流讀取,客戶端支持多協(xié)議多格式播放視頻,服務(wù)端和客戶端通過一種特殊的文件格式實現(xiàn)通信。

舉例來說,直播/錄播通信文件格式的示例可以如下所示:

總之,本發(fā)明通過一種特殊的視頻文件加載格式實現(xiàn)了一個直播/錄播音視頻流即可實現(xiàn)流媒體的全平臺(iOS、安卓、Windows、Mac)適配播放。本發(fā)明實現(xiàn)了直播/錄播一次發(fā)布即可同時支持多種協(xié)議(RTMP/HLS)多種終端(iOS、安卓、PC及Mac)流暢高清播放。而且,本發(fā)明可以自動適配客戶端平臺并選擇合適的播放器格式,例如HTML5播放器或者Flash播放器。

本發(fā)明兼容性強,一個直播/錄播流適配多種協(xié)議多種平臺;而且,本發(fā)明可以適應(yīng)多種場景,既支持直播又支持錄播。

需要說明的是,除非特別指出,否則說明書中的術(shù)語“第一”、“第二”、“第三”等描述僅僅用于區(qū)分說明書中的各個組件、元素、步驟等,而不是用于表示各個組件、元素、步驟之間的邏輯關(guān)系或者順序關(guān)系等。

可以理解的是,雖然本發(fā)明已以較佳實施例披露如上,然而上述實施例并非用以限定本發(fā)明。對于任何熟悉本領(lǐng)域的技術(shù)人員而言,在不脫離本發(fā)明技術(shù)方案范圍情況下,都可利用上述揭示的技術(shù)內(nèi)容對本發(fā)明技術(shù)方案作出許多可能的變動和修飾,或修改為等同變化的等效實施例。因此,凡是未脫離本發(fā)明技術(shù)方案的內(nèi)容,依據(jù)本發(fā)明的技術(shù)實質(zhì)對以上實施例所做的任何簡單修改、等同變化及修飾,均仍屬于本發(fā)明技術(shù)方案保護(hù)的范圍內(nèi)。

當(dāng)前第1頁1 2 3 
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1
沁源县| 永春县| 沾化县| 全州县| 河北区| 固始县| 葫芦岛市| 巴青县| 万荣县| 宽城| 通化市| 瑞金市| 蓬安县| 平顺县| 琼海市| 格尔木市| 丽水市| 巩义市| 梨树县| 黄龙县| 娄底市| 分宜县| 房产| 永福县| 保定市| 瓮安县| 新闻| 繁昌县| 德格县| 汤阴县| 澄江县| 英德市| 略阳县| 禹城市| 龙川县| 东台市| 大悟县| 茶陵县| 比如县| 武山县| 德州市|